1. Natural Elements: Embrace the Beauty of Nature
Nature provides an abundance of materials that can be transformed into stunning Christmas decorations. Pine cones, holly berries, and evergreen boughs can be gathered from your backyard or nearby park. Arrange them in a bowl, vase, or on a plate to create a rustic and festive centerpiece. Embellish with a few drops of essential oils, such as cinnamon or pine, to enhance the ambiance.
2. DIY Paper Crafts: Unleash Your Creativity
Paper is an incredibly versatile material that can be used to create a variety of Christmas decorations. Cut out snowflakes, stars, or ornaments from colorful paper and string them together to create garlands. Fold origami reindeer or Christmas trees and place them on the table as charming accents. You can even use paper to make miniature Christmas villages, complete with houses, trees, and snowmen.
3. Upcycled Treasures: Transform Old into New
Take a fresh look at everyday objects and see how you can repurpose them into Christmas decorations. Old jars can be painted red or green and filled with candy canes or ornaments. Empty tin cans can be covered with festive paper and used as candle holders. Wine corks can be strung together to create a garland or glued to a piece of wood to form a Christmas tree.
4. Fabric Embellishments: Add a Touch of Texture
Fabric scraps, ribbons, and lace can be used to create beautiful and inexpensive Christmas decorations. Sew or glue fabric scraps together to make table runners, napkins, or coasters. Tie ribbons around candles or vases for a festive touch. Cut out lace snowflakes and glue them to the edges of plates or glasses.
5. Repurposed Christmas Cards: Spread Holiday Cheer
Don’t throw away those old Christmas cards! Cut out the festive images and use them to create garlands, ornaments, or gift tags. You can also frame them and display them on the table as a charming reminder of past holidays.
6. Inexpensive Candles: Create a Warm Glow
Candles are an essential part of Christmas decor, providing both light and ambiance. Look for inexpensive candles in festive colors and scents. Place them in candle holders or on a tray to create a warm and inviting glow on your table.
7. Christmas-Themed Tableware: Set a Festive Table
Use Christmas-themed plates, glasses, and napkins to add a festive touch to your table. You can find inexpensive sets at discount stores or online retailers. Consider using red and green plates, snowflake-patterned glasses, or reindeer-shaped napkins to create a cohesive look.
8. DIY Centerpieces: Showcase Your Creativity
Create a stunning centerpiece without spending a fortune. Fill a vase with evergreen boughs and add a few ornaments or pinecones. Use a candle as a focal point and surround it with Christmas-themed figurines or ornaments. You can also create a miniature Christmas tree using a small branch or a piece of cardboard.
9. Festive Garland: Add a Touch of Cheer
Garlands are a great way to add a festive touch to your table. String together popcorn, cranberries, or candy canes to create a unique and inexpensive garland. You can also use fabric scraps, ribbon, or paper to create your own custom garland.
10. Christmas Lights: Illuminate the Season
Christmas lights are a must-have for any festive table. Wrap them around the base of a centerpiece, string them along the edge of the table, or use them to create a backdrop for your Christmas display. Choose lights in warm white or colored hues to create a cozy and inviting atmosphere.
11. DIY Ornaments: Express Your Style
Create your own Christmas ornaments using inexpensive materials such as felt, paper, or clay. Cut out shapes, paint them, or decorate them with glitter and beads. You can also use old jewelry or buttons to create unique and personalized ornaments.
12. Festive Napkin Rings: Add a Touch of Elegance
Napkin rings are a simple but effective way to dress up your table for Christmas. Use ribbon, twine, or fabric scraps to create your own napkin rings. You can also use small ornaments or pinecones to add a festive touch.
13. Candy and Treats: A Sweet Addition
Fill a bowl or plate with Christmas candy, such as candy canes, chocolate coins, or gingerbread cookies. This not only adds a festive touch to your table but also provides a sweet treat for your guests.
14. Christmas Music: Set the Mood
Create a festive atmosphere by playing Christmas music in the background. Choose a playlist that includes traditional carols, instrumental music, or your favorite holiday tunes.
15. Personalized Touches: Make it Meaningful
Add personal touches to your Christmas table decorations to make them truly special. Write your guests’ names on place cards or create small gift bags filled with treats. Display family photos or cherished Christmas ornaments to create a warm and inviting atmosphere.
16. DIY Snow Globes: Create a Winter Wonderland
Create your own miniature winter wonderlands by filling small jars with water and glitter. Add a small Christmas tree or figurine to the center and seal the jar tightly. Turn the jar upside down to create a magical snow globe that will add a touch of enchantment to your table.
